Today is School Nurse Day, a day dedicated to honoring and recognizing the contributions of school nurses in providing quality healthcare to students in schools.
School nurses are crucial in promoting the health and well-being of students, staff, and their families. They provide various services, including health screenings, first aid, medication administration, and health education. They also serve as a liaison between the school, families, and healthcare providers to ensure students receive the appropriate care they need to thrive academically and physically.
On School Nurse Day, schools and communities are encouraged to show their appreciation for our school nurses. #SchoolNursesRock
